Technological Assessment and Support Service for Children and the Curriculum
Technological Assessment and Support Service for Children and the Curriculum (TASSCC) provides a service for children with learning or communication difficulties, which can be helped by using computer technology. We do assessments, give advice on educational technology and organise CPD training sessions on educational hardware and software.

Employing Support Workers in Higher Education-A guide for students
This Scottish Government publication is a guide for students with disabilities who receive the Disabled Students Allowance and need to employ support workers. This booklet provides guidance about getting assistance from different types of helpers or support workers in higher education. It looks at ways to arrange this support and some of the things to think about if a person chooses to employ their own assistant.
